Every prized piece of jewelry begins life as a single stroke on paper.
Uncovering the lesser-known world of jewelry design sketches, the book “Designing Jewels” presents drawings from Tiffany, Lalique and Vever, alongside that of renowned workshops, including Paillet, Brédillard and Mellerio- Borgnis, offering a glimpse of the creative process that both chronicles the making of a jewel and is a veritable work of art in its own right.
From a technical tool used by the professions, the jewelry drawing has become a full-fledged work of art in itself, collected by knowledgeable art lovers.
